Description

Croft Cottage, located at No 52 on The Croft, dates from around 1800. It features a painted mathematical tile front set on a brick base, with tile-hung sides and a slate hipped roof. The building has two storeys and a basement, with two windows that are sashes with glazing bars in flush casings. To the right, there is a fielded-panel door situated in a tall pilastered doorcase, which includes a frieze, a wide cornice, and a rectangular fanlight with glazing bars. Croft Cottage is part of a group with Nos 48 to 54, where No 54 is noted as a building of local interest only.
